Maximum contaminant levels (MCLs) are standards that are set by the United States Environmental Protection Agency (EPA) for drinking water quality. [ 1 ] [ 2 ] An MCL is the legal threshold limit on the amount of a substance that is allowed in public water systems under the Safe Drinking Water Act (SDWA).
The National Emission Standards for Hazardous Air Pollutants (NESHAP) are air pollution standards issued by the United States Environmental Protection Agency (EPA). The standards, authorized by the Clean Air Act, are for pollutants not covered by the National Ambient Air Quality Standards (NAAQS) that may cause an increase in fatalities or in serious, irreversible, or incapacitating illness.

The Lead and Copper Rule (LCR) is a United States federal regulation that limits the concentration of lead and copper allowed in public drinking water at the consumer's tap, as well as limiting the permissible amount of pipe corrosion occurring due to the water itself. EPA has set standards for over 90 contaminants organized into six groups: microorganisms, disinfectants, disinfection byproducts, inorganic chemicals, organic chemicals and radionuclides. [12] States and territories must implement rules that are at least as stringent as EPA's to retain primary enforcement authority (primacy) over drinking water.

In 1977, the EPA published a document which detailed the Air Quality Criteria for lead. This document was based on the scientific assessments of lead at the time. Based on this report (1977 Lead AQCD), the EPA established a "1.5 μg/m 3 (maximum quarterly calendar average) Pb NAAQS in 1978."
